
Ashok Kumar Khadka, Patron of Padmoday Foundation, has made a generous contribution of Rs. 51,000 as a Dalit God to the annual fair held at the historic Salahes Temple in Kasaha, Dhangadhimai-7,, Dhangadhimai-7. This fair, celebrated every year on Baisakh 1st, holds significant cultural and historical importance in the region.
Speaking about his support, Ashok Kumar Khadka emphasized his commitment to preserving and promoting local traditions and culture. He stated, “This fair is a vital part of our heritage, and I am dedicated to ensuring its continuity and growth in the years to come.”

The financial assistance provided by Khadka will aid in the smooth organization of the fair, which attracts numerous devotees and visitors each year. The community expressed deep gratitude for his continued support and encouragement toward cultural preservation.
